Output 30930511afc24afcf1d7422a660979460f252fc9e173c38343c31f38cba9e00d:0

value
24019913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d30b9597eb825724710905763217c4a1d2323f OP_EQUAL
address
M9oGZww6j78mnpDUi48KrQayzdoJPHfMWq
transaction
30930511afc24afcf1d7422a660979460f252fc9e173c38343c31f38cba9e00d
spent
true